Identified Scams Relevant to Audemars Piguet Royal Oak Transactions
- ✓ **Token Grabber:** Scammers may send malicious links disguised as exclusive deals or authentication requests. Clicking these links can compromise your Discord account, potentially leading to the theft of your credentials or any sensitive information shared within the platform.
- ✓ **Crypto Rain/Scam:** While not directly related to watch sales, scammers might use 'crypto rain' or similar promotions to gain trust or lure victims into unrelated fraudulent schemes. This could be a tactic to establish credibility before attempting to sell a counterfeit watch or scam you out of funds.
- ✓ **Game Art Commission/Bot Developer Invite:** These are often lures to get users to click on malicious links or install unverified software. In the context of watch trading, a scammer might pose as a developer offering a 'verified trader' badge or a 'special marketplace tool' that, in reality, is a token grabber or malware.
- ✓ **Free Nitro Link/Server Boost Deal/Early Access Badge:** These are classic phishing tactics. Scammers offer enticing digital goods or status symbols to trick users into sharing personal information or clicking harmful links. Applying these to watch sales, they might promise a 'verified buyer' status or exclusive access to deals via a fake link.
Be extremely wary of unsolicited DMs offering Audemars Piguet Royal Oak deals that seem too good to be true. Always verify seller legitimacy through independent means.
The Audemars Piguet Royal Oak is a high-value item, making it a prime target for counterfeiters. Scammers often try to pass off replicas as genuine pieces. These fakes can be sophisticated, but often have tell-tale signs such as incorrect case thickness, poorly executed 'tapisserie' dials, misaligned bezel screws, or inferior engraving quality. Always conduct thorough due diligence and, if possible, seek expert authentication.
